Finding GCD of 937, 201, 40, 725 using Prime Factorization

Given Input Data is 937, 201, 40, 725

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 937 is 937

Prime Factorization of 201 is 3 x 67

Prime Factorization of 40 is 2 x 2 x 2 x 5

Prime Factorization of 725 is 5 x 5 x 29

The above numbers do not have any common prime factor. So GCD is 1
